Project name: Trichophyton rubrum BMU01672
Description: The State Key Laboratory for Molecular Virology and Genetic Engineering, National Institute for Viral Disease Control and Prevention (China) sequenced 34,670 ESTs from Trichophyton rubrum strain BMU01672.EST sequences were produced from 10 different cDNA libraries (representing mycelium and spores) covering nearly the entire growth phase. The 11,085 unique ESTs were clustered into 3,816 contigs and 7,269 singletons. The 7,764 (70%) ESTs corresponded to putative functions or matched homologs from other organisms. It is assumed that another 3,321 (30%) of ESTs with no similarity to known sequences will represent novel genes. The sequences have been submitted to GenBank under accession numbers: DW405580-DW407270,DW678211-DW711189 and EB801452-EB801703.
